学位论文 > 优秀研究生学位论文题录展示
几种并行AMG法及其在辐射扩散问题中的应用
作 者: 岳孝强
导 师: 舒适
学 校: 湘潭大学
专 业: 计算数学
关键词: 辐射扩散问题 AMG法 聚集法 并行计算 CPU+GPU异构计算
分类号: O246
类 型: 硕士论文
年 份: 2012年
下 载: 16次
引 用: 0次
阅 读: 论文下载
内容摘要
并行AMG法是求解偏微分方程离散化系统最为有效的迭代法之一. CPU+GPU异构计算机已成为高性能计算机发展的重要趋势, MPI/OpenMP+CUDA是能充分发挥高性能异构计算机有效峰值的主要并行编程环境.目前面向异构计算机系统的并行AMG法及其实现技术,还有许多值得研究的问题,本文的工作主要有以下两个部分:第一部分针对一类系数矩阵为稀疏带状结构的线性代数方程组,在OpenMP并行编程环境下,对HYPRE中默认的AMG (BoomerAMG)解法器内的并行插值算子和并行粗网格算子的生成模块进行了改进.通过给出这两个模块中相应辅助数组的有效长度及偏移量的估计式,得到了具有更少内存开销的辅助数组及其计算公式,并研制了相应的程序模块.数值实验结果表明,改进的BoomerAMG解法器提高了原解法器的求解能力和并行计算效率.第二部分针对CPU和GPU不同的工作特点,研究了几种常用的UA-AMG法及其应用,具体表现为:关于CPU下的串行UA-AMG法,基于VMB聚集法,通过结合几种常用的Cycle和利用转换算子的特性,给出了具有更低运算复杂性的UA-AMG法,研制了相应的程序模块,并将以这些UA-AMG法为预条件子的PCG法应用于二维单温辐射扩散模型问题.数值实验结果表明, UA-NA-CG-s法最为稳健高效,且比目前国际上已有的HYPRE、AGMG以及Cusp软件包中常用的基于AMG预条件子的PCG法具有更高的计算效率.关于GPU下的并行UA-AMG法,基于MIS(2)聚集法和带权Jacobi磨光算法,给出了具有更低运算复杂性的UA-AMG法,研制了相应的程序模块,并将以这些UA-AMG法为预条件子的PCG法应用于二维单温辐射扩散模型问题.数值实验结果表明, UA-W-CG-p法最为稳健高效,且比Cusp软件包中基于SA-AMG预条件子的PCG法更为高效.在此基础上,结合几种结构网格下的红黑序Gauss-Seidel磨光算法研究了相应的UA-AMG法,并将其对应的PCG法应用于上述模型问题.数值实验结果表明,这些PCG法也是稳健的,且并行计算效率更高.
|
全文目录
摘要 5-6 Abstract 6-9 第一章 绪论 9-16 1.1 研究背景 9-11 1.2 本文的主要工作及内容安排 11-13 1.3 预备知识 13-16 第二章 OpenMP编程环境下BoomerAMG解法器的一种改进 16-29 2.1 一种并行插值算子的改进算法 16-19 2.2 一种并行粗网格算子的改进算法 19-24 2.3 数值实验 24-29 第三章 几种求解一类二维单温辐射扩散问题的UA-AMG法 29-50 3.1 一类二维单温辐射扩散问题及其SFVE格式 29-33 3.2 CPU下的串行UA-AMG法 33-42 3.3 GPU下的并行UA-AMG法 42-46 3.4 基于红黑序Gauss-Seidel磨光的并行UA-AMG法 46-50 结论和展望 50-51 参考文献 51-55 致谢 55-56 个人简历、在学期间发表的学术论文及研究成果 56
|
相似论文
- 基于CUDA的图像数字水印技术的研究,TP309.7
- 基于MPI的三维地层建模和可视化方法研究,TP391.41
- 光学衍射场次级衍射的研究,O436.1
- 并发系统的并行计算及性能分析,TP338.6
- 环境一号卫星CCD影像云去除方法研究及并行化实现,P228
- 基于GPU加速FDTD计算速度的研究与仿真,TN011
- 基于GPU的有限元方法研究,O241.82
- 遗传算法在多核系统上的性能分析和优化,TP18
- 保护在线自适应整定的研究,TM77
- 云环境下MapReduce容错技术的研究,TP302.8
- 高动态SINS导航解算算法及其并行化研究,TN966
- 基于CPU的源强反算算法研究,TP18
- 基于段落指纹的大规模近似网页检测算法研究,TP393.092
- 并行与双系统协同差异进化算法及其应用,TP18
- 基于网格与并行技术的电力系统动态安全评估,TM712
- 微尺度流体流动和混合的LBM模拟,TQ021.1
- GRAPES有限区域切线/伴随模式高效并行算法研究,TP301.6
- 求解二阶混合有限体元离散系统的高效预条件子,O241.82
- 拖曳线列阵平台背景信号仿真模块设计,U666.7
- 基于MPI的并行遗传算法在0-1背包问题中的应用研究,TP18
- 考虑动态安全约束的电力系统机组组合研究,TM73
中图分类: > 数理科学和化学 > 数学 > 计算数学 > 数值并行计算
© 2012 www.xueweilunwen.com
|